New York vs Philadelphia
How do occupancy limits rules compare between New York, NY and Philadelphia, PA?
Philadelphia has fewer restrictions than New York.
New York, NY
New York County
Local Law 18 of 2022 (Admin Code ยง26-18) requires all short-term rental hosts to register with the Mayor's Office of Special Enforcement (OSE). Only the permanent resident may host, and no more than 2 paying guests are allowed at a time. The host must be present during the stay.

Philadelphia County
Philadelphia does not have a dedicated short-term rental ordinance with specific occupancy caps. STRs must comply with the general rental license requirements of Phila. Code Chapter 9-3900 and applicable building/fire code occupancy limits. The Philadelphia Fire Code and building code set maximum occupancy based on egress and floor area.

New York FAQ
How many guests can I have in my NYC short-term rental?
Under Local Law 18 of 2022, you may host no more than 2 paying guests at a time. You must be physically present during the stay and registered with the Mayor's Office of Special Enforcement.
Can I rent my entire apartment on Airbnb in NYC?
Not for stays under 30 days unless you are physically present. The Multiple Dwelling Law and Local Law 18 effectively prohibit whole-apartment short-term rentals in most NYC buildings.
Philadelphia FAQ
Does Philadelphia have occupancy limits for short-term rentals?
Philadelphia does not have STR-specific occupancy caps. General building and fire code occupancy limits apply based on egress capacity and floor area. All rental units require a license under Phila. Code ยง9-3902.
Do I need a rental license for an Airbnb in Philadelphia?
Yes. All dwelling units let for occupancy require a rental license under Phila. Code ยง9-3902, which costs $55 per unit annually. You must also collect and remit the Hotel Tax and the city Business Income and Receipts Tax.
